Sharp Object-Oriented Development: Concepts & Examples

Object-oriented development (OOP) is a core paradigm in C#, allowing developers to build applications around objects rather than procedures. Key ideas include data hiding, which combines data and methods that work on that data; extending, enabling the creation of new classes from existing ones, supporting code reuse; and variability, permitting objects of different classes to be treated as objects of a common type. For demonstration, consider a `Vehicle` class with properties like `speed` and `color`. You could then create child classes like `Car` and `Truck`, each inheriting the `speed` and `color` properties from `Vehicle` but adding their own unique properties and methods, like `numDoors` for `Car` or `cargoCapacity` for `Truck`. This modular architecture greatly improves code maintainability and expansion in larger projects.
